How do you switch to electric in a hybrid car?
Switching to electric driving mode in a hybrid car can depend on the model. It’s typically automatic, though. Providing the car’s battery is fully charged – or has enough charge – your journey will start in pure electric mode.
When the battery capacity is close to running out – and hybrid cars have much smaller batteries than all-electric models – the vehicle will switch to being powered by the petrol or diesel engine, so the driver never has to worry about ‘running out of charge’.
With some hybrid car models, you may also be able to switch between pure electric mode and engine manually.
